The name of the plugin.
### enable
- Type: `boolean`
- Default: true
Configure whether to enable this plugin. e.g. if you want to enable a plugin only in development mode:
``` js
module.exports=(options,context)=>{
return{
enable:!context.isProd
}
}
```
